Leaf vegetables have very low calorie count, no fat content to speak of, a lot of dietary fibre, iron and calcium, and are very high in phytochemicals such as vitamin C, carotenoids, lutein, foliate and vitamin K. This means they improve bowel movement, reduce cancer risk and have such low carbohydrate content that they are virtually carb-free. Lettuce, broccoli, spinach, sprouts, cucumbers and about a 1000 more plants have edible leaves so you really are spoilt for choice.
